Humphrey Douglas
Profile
Humphrey Douglas is an energy partner with international experience throughout the energy value chain, Humphrey previously acted as a General Counsel for a major Middle Eastern energy company. Humphrey's oil and gas experience includes regulatory, joint ventures and commercial contracts. His recent unconventional experience includes working on Total's entry to the UK shale market and advising a national oil company on its sale of onshore oil and gas assets and what is believed to be the UK's first coal-bed methane and shale-derived long term gas sales agreement. Humphrey is currently working for: the developer of a shale-derived LNG re-gas, oil and Ethane importation and trans-shipment terminal in the Western Hemisphere; a national oil company on its proposed acquisition of NW Europe's largest oil field; and for a Japanese trading house on a substantial upstream development and joint venture involving the Russian Government. Humphrey is a regional committee member of the Energy Institute and is also a member of the Association of International Petroleum Negotiators.
